Place Standard “How good is our place”

Ms Steehouder-Ross introduced herself and explained what her job was.

She is part of a team who are finding out what people think about/feel about the community we are a part of in Kincorth. They are looking for feedback about a number of things e.g services and facilities that we have in Kincorth and if we think they are good or need to be improved or introduced.

She is going to come into school in the next few weeks and will talk to classes to gather their thoughts and opinions.

There will be a community event held in the Scout Hut on 34th November. There will be posters and booklets in many local places explaining this further.

Parent Council

Today at our first meeting, we had a visit from Mrs Ritchie on behalf of the Parent Council.

Mrs Ritchie explained to us what the Parent Council do and gave us some examples. They organise the school discos and the sponsored walk. They support the school by providing bookbags for the younger pupils and help pay for the P7 Final Fling.

Mrs Ritchie explained that the Parent Council would like to work more closely with the Pupil Council.

The Parent Council are looking for new members this year. She explained that new Parent members can bring along their children to meetings. Activities will be available for the children to do during the meetings.

Mrs Ritchie has asked the Pupil Council for their support by talking to their class about the Parent Council and encouraging children to talk to their parents about it.

She has also asked the members to ask pupils for their ideas for a family evening as the disco is unavailable in October. She explained that in the past they have had a bingo evening and a beetle drive.

Council members will consult with their classes and bring their responses along to our next meeting.
